Look Who Brought Snacks

A game where the computer is doing basic (work-related) actions. Your only job is being the person to grab snacks and give them to the computer characters :p

Input / Movement

Players automatically move left/right through the building.

By pressing your button, you take the elevator, whatever way it’s going right now.

You automatically deliver appropriate food if you have it and they want it.

Map

Probably best as a side-view platformer type thing.

You are inside a building. The other people are having important meetings, doing work, etcetera. You were assigned snack duty.

I’m in doubt whether this should be a big office. Or a cute, small country house with a more informal setting. Maybe both, through different levels.

So you have to jump around, restock the fridge, grab snacks, and deliver them to people doing hard work or being in important meetings.

Specific Rules

People can have two states:

  • Energy being depleted => deliver a snack full of energy in time
  • Bored/sleepy => deliver a spicy snack
  • Angry/irritated => deliver a nutritional snack

As time changes, your snacks must change. Breakfast food in the morning, lunch in the afternoon, warm dinner in the evening.

The temperature also means something later on? (Hot = give ice and cold foods, Cold = give tea and warm foods.) Can be different per room?
